A 20 mile round trip to have the pre-summer service done - over the Danube and into a not-so-lovely industrial zone. Peter used to look after my Spitfire, in fact still looks after it for the new owner. He operates from a tiny workshop in a builders yard just beyond the city limits. He has worked on British sports cars all of his life and is what we call a "geheim tip" - a secret worth sharing. There was an early razor edge Triumph saloon outside but Healeys and MGs are more common customers. He's now a member of the silver-haired mechanics club and I fear he might hang up the spanners before too long. In the meantime I will give him my custom and send mates there as well. As well as the service he gave the car a good once-over and, a man of few words, gave it the thumbs-up.
And is it just me or does the Morgan always steer more lightly, rev more freely and just drive more sweetly on the way home from a service?
